CVE-2026-42423
HIGH · CVSS 7.5
EPSS exploitation probability: 0%
Published 2026-04-28T19:37:46.083 · Last modified 2026-06-17T10:47:48.840

Summary

OpenClaw before 2026.4.8 contains an approval-timeout fallback mechanism that bypasses strictInlineEval explicit-approval requirements on gateway and node exec hosts. Attackers can exploit this timeout fallback to execute inline eval commands that should require explicit user approval, circumventing the intended security boundary.

Affected products

openclaw — openclaw
